# Environment Variables — ThumbForge Queue

ThumbForge consumes upload events and generates thumbnails at three fixed sizes. For release cuts, verify QUEUE_NAME matches the environment (thumb-prod vs thumb-stage) and that MAX_RETRIES is 5; lower values drop images under load. WORKER_COUNT should scale with instance size, never above 16. Workers write finished thumbnails to the Dallowmere object store, which requires an access credential at startup. That credential is set on the line that follows:

secret setting of yajog-taguf: ARCHIVE_KEY3=051

## Authentication

All jobs submitted to the Vexlight transcoding farm must authenticate against the internal Jobgate service. As a contractor, you will not use your personal credentials; instead, every request includes the shared farm key in the `X-Jobgate-Auth` header. Treat this key as confidential, never commit it to source control, and request rotation if exposed. The current key is shown below.

app token of badug-tahaf = qvz11-nP5FBNr8qnh

# Heads-up for contractors joining the Brickforge migration!
# We're moving the old Makefile mess into Brickforge's hermetic build
# system, which means no more network fetches mid-build. Everything
# gets pinned in the lockfile, including the schema snapshot step.
# That step still needs to pull table definitions at snapshot time,
# which happens outside the sandbox. For that one exception, the
# snapshot tool reads the connection string below.

warehouse DSN: mssql://rusdor_svc:0FSWCn9@db-951a.paliqforge.local:5432/ulawyn

Subject: Recalled chargers — pick-up today

Hi dispatch,

Quick heads-up: the pallet of recalled Arclight chargers in bay 2 goes out today with Fernway Couriers, not the usual run. Keep the recall paperwork taped to the wrap — they'll refuse it otherwise. When the driver arrives, follow the confidential hand-over instruction below.

Thanks,
Mira

drop instructions, taguf-yahag: the oliiel druael courier leaves the briys zoriel aldmir ledger at gate 6837 under passcode 242028